AP psychology cram
Key Concepts to Study:
- Research Methods
- Types of Research: Experimental, Correlational, Observational
- Ethical Guidelines
- Biological Bases of Behavior
- Neurons and Neurotransmitters
- Brain Structures and Functions
- Endocrine System
- Developmental Psychology
- Stages of Development: Cognitive, Social, Emotional
- Major Theorists: Piaget, Erikson, Vygotsky
- Learning Theories
- Classical Conditioning: Pavlov
- Operant Conditioning: Skinner
- Observational Learning: Bandura
- Cognitive Psychology
- Memory Models: Short-term, Long-term, Working Memory
- Problem Solving and Decision Making
- Motivation and Emotion
- Theories of Motivation
- Theories of Emotion: Cannon-Bard, James-Lange
- Personality
- Major Theories: Psychoanalytic, Humanistic, Trait
- Assessment Methods: Interviews, Questionnaires
- Psychological Disorders
- Classification of Disorders: DSM-5
- Major Disorders: Anxiety, Mood, Personality, Schizophrenia
- Therapies
- Major Approaches: Psychotherapy, Biomedical therapies
- Techniques and Effectiveness
- Social Psychology
- Key Concepts: Group Behavior, Social Influence, Attribution Theory
- Major Studies: Milgram, Zimbardo
